More about this title

Why we love this

Brunner's arrangement respects the lyrical weight of the text while keeping the voicing accessible for SSA ensembles. The writing sits naturally in the range and tessiture, which means singers stay comfortable across the full six pages. You get genuine harmonic depth without requiring soloists or unusual ranges.

What to expect

The piece carries a meditative quality without sentimentality. Brunner's harmonies move with purposeful restraint, letting the text breathe while the voices create soft, overlapping layers of sound.

Who it's for

SSA and SSAA choirs looking for something with classical anchoring and contemporary warmth. Works equally well for high school ensembles with solid fundamentals or collegiate groups seeking shorter, focused repertoire.

How to get the most out of it

  • Balance the soprano and alto lines carefully in moments where they move in sixths or thirds; too much soprano weight will bury the harmonic color Brunner creates.
  • Work dynamics as a group first, then refine how individual lines shape the phrase. A small gesture from you often clarifies the ensemble's collective direction better than individual corrections.
  • Mark your score with breath points that work for all three parts simultaneously where possible. Staggered breathing creates holes in sustained chords.

How to use it

Pair this with Renaissance or contemporary spirituals to create a thoughtful first half. At six pages, it functions as either a centerpiece on a shorter concert or a balancing anchor when you're programming contrasting styles.

Skills your students will build

  • Sustaining a lyrical legit tone across longer phrases
  • Blending three independent lines without losing line clarity
  • Following harmonic direction through unison and divisi sections
  • Responsive dynamics that serve text meaning rather than dramatic effect
